The water coming into my house seems to be pulsing rather than flowing
continuously. The cold water tap in the kitchen works fine, no spluttering or anything, but gently pulses. There is also a regular dull banging sound coming from any pipes directly connected to the mains, consistent with the pulsing of the water coming out of the kitchen tap. This noise, which sounds a bit like a heartbeat, remains constant regardless of what taps are running. The next door neighbours don't seem to have this problem. Thames Water say there's been no disruption to the pipes in the area. Any thoughts as to what could be causing the irregular flow? Thanks in advance |
